W500 Blu Ray drive - can it write dual layer DVDs?

Posted: Wed Apr 29, 2009 11:22 am
by lifesizepotato
I have a W500 with Vista 64 Business. It's a clean install on a new hard drive.

I recently have been struggling trying to my system to burn to dual layer DVDs. The problem is, the Panasonic Matashita UJ 232A Blu Ray recordable drive doesn't even RECOGNIZE blank dual layer DVDs, let alone write to them.

I checked with Nero InfoTool and, sure enough, it tells me that the drive is incapable of writing to DVD+-R DL. This doesn't seem right to me, since the drive can do pretty much everything else, including writing dual layer Blu Ray discs. Also, as far as I can tell, other vendors (on eBay) say the drive can write DL DVDs. Plus, I think that is a pretty standard capability nowadays.

I thought it might be due to my fresh install, so I put the original hard drive back in to see if that was the case. I booted up on the factory drive, which is almost completely untouched, and even there I can't do anything with my blank DVD-R DL discs.

These are Memorex discs, which I hear aren't the best, but to me it seems clear that my machine, even from the factory, thinks this drive can't write to DVD-R DLs.

Can someone with the drive check this out for me? If you have Nero InfoTool, you can just run that and it tells you the drive's abilities.

I have a feeling I may need to send it back on warranty to get a new drive.

Dell's support site says that the UJ232A does not write dual layer DVD-R or DVD+R.

http://support.dell.com/support/edocs/s ... n/spec.htm

edit: And this from Lenovo.com

http://www-307.ibm.com/pc/support/site. ... MIGR-70234

appears to say that DVD+R DL and DVD-R DL is supported only on reads, not writes:
Reads or writes data with speedy maximum data transfer rates of:

* 16x maximum (writing to CD-R media)
* 10x maximum (writing to CD-RW media)
* 5x maximum (writing to DVD-RAM media)
* 8x maximum (writing to DVD+/-R media) <-- DL not listed
* 4x maximum (writing to DVD+/-RW media) <-- DL not listed
* 2x maximum (writing to BD-R/RE SL media)
* 1x maximum (writing to BD-R/RE DL media)
* 24x maximum (reading CD-ROM, CD-R media)
* 24x maximum (reading CD-RW media)
* 8x maximum (reading DVD-ROM/-R/+R SL media)
* 6x maximum (reading DVD-ROM/-R/+R DL media) <-- DL is listed
* 6x maximum (reading DVD-RW/+RW media)
* 5x maximum (reading DVD-RAM media)
* 2x maximum (reading BD-ROM media)
* 2x maximum (reading BD-R/RE SL/DL media)
